你提供的代码统计的count在不同成语后重复出现且数值偏大是为什么(成语已经去重))
时间: 2024-04-22 14:21:37 浏览: 15
如果成语已经去重,那么代码中出现的重复计数问题可能是因为某些成语出现了多次而且每次出现都被计入了总数。这种情况通常是由于计数的实现逻辑存在问题,比如在每次匹配到成语时都进行计数,而没有考虑到同一个成语可能会在不同位置反复出现的情况。为了避免这种情况,可以在计数时采用一些限制条件,如只在每个成语在整个句子中首次出现时进行计数,或者只计算每个句子中出现的成语总数而不对重复出现的成语进行计数。这样可以保证计数结果准确无误。
相关问题
你提供的代码统计的count在不同成语后重复出现且数值偏大是为什么
可能是因为代码中对重复计数的实现方式不够严谨或者存在逻辑上的问题。比如,如果在计数时没有将成语进行唯一性判断,那么同一个成语在不同位置出现时就会重复计数;另外,如果在计数时没有对成语出现的位置进行限制,那么可能会将不同部分中的相同成语都计入总数,导致数值偏大。这些问题都需要在代码实现中进行处理,以确保计数结果准确无误。
你提供的代码统计的count在不同成语后重复出现且数值偏大是为什么(成语已经去重)并且该代码是统计分割后的成语列表,不存在多个位置出现
如果成语已经去重并且代码是统计分割后的成语列表,不存在多个位置出现,那么可能是代码实现中的逻辑错误导致了计数偏大的问题。一种可能的情况是,在计数时没有对成语列表进行正确的遍历,导致有些成语被重复计数了多次。另一种可能是,在计数时没有进行正确的累加操作,而是每次都重新从0开始计数,导致了计数结果的偏大。为了解决这些问题,需要对代码逻辑进行仔细的检查和修改,确保计数结果的准确性。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![7z](https://img-home.csdnimg.cn/images/20210720083312.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)